È una chiave che ti permetterà di scaricare il gioco Mighty No. 9 sulla tua PS4 dalle piattaforme di download ufficiali.
Al 16/07/2026, in Italy, il miglior prezzo che abbiamo trovato nella nostra selezione di negozi online che includono la chiave di Mighty No. 9 su PS4 è di 7.12€.
Il formato PSN Key è quello che raccomandiamo sempre, perché è molto più facile da usare e sicuro rispetto a qualsiasi altro formato. Basta inserire la chiave nel proprio account per scaricare Mighty No. 9 nella propria libreria di giochi. Il formato account richiede passaggi più complicati per l’attivazione e questo processo può comportare più errori rispetto all’inserimento diretto di una chiave.
L’unico problema che abbiamo riscontrato in 13 anni è una chiave duplicata che non funziona. In tal caso, basta contattare il negozio presso cui hai acquistato Mighty No. 9 e ti invieranno una nuova chiave. Puoi anche contattarci direttamente e ti aiuteremo noi.
I tempi di consegna variano in base al negozio. Ad esempio, nel caso di Instatgaming, Eneba, G2a o Kinguin, la consegna è solitamente immediata o richiede solo pochi minuti. Questi negozi raramente ritardano nella consegna dei giochi.
Altri negozi possono impiegare fino a 30-40 minuti, a seconda della disponibilità dei giochi. In occasione del lancio di un gioco, i tempi potrebbero allungarsi un po’.
